Clear a Surface, Clear Your Mind

Pick one space—the nightstand, your desk, your dresser. Don’t get overwhelmed by the whole room. Just choose one. Wipe it down gently. Put things back slowly. Notice how every item has a home, just like you do. As the surface clears, so does your mind. Your hands are busy, but your heart feels quiet.

This isn’t about minimalism. It’s about mental breathing room.
